Hydrophilic PES Membrane Filters: Performance and Applications
Polyether Sulfone membrane filters offer a significant advantage in filtration processes due to their inherent water-loving nature. This property reduces biofouling and maintains consistent flux compared to hydrophobic alternatives. Their excellent chemical resistance and thermal stability enable application in a wide range of industries, including biopharmaceutical production, water purification, and food and beverage processing. Specific uses span from sterile filtration of cell culture broth to prefiltration for reverse osmosis systems, demonstrating their versatility and broad applicability.
